Description:

Occupational therapy practitioners bring a unique perspective to the healthcare team, in that OTPs focus on the daily function, meaning, and participation within ADLs such as toileting. In the pediatric population, the OTP role has continued to grow and become more valuable due to the need for holistic intervention regarding pediatric bowel and bladder health and continuation with toileting goals. OTPs practicing in pediatrics need a deeper understanding of pelvic health and how this impacts toilet training and toileting skills.

Course Objectives:
At the conclusion of this course, participants will be able to:
  • Identify the signs of toilet training readiness and strategies to improve toilet training readiness
  • Identify and describe 3 client factors that impact toilet training readiness including pelvic floor function
  • Describe 3 motor skills requiring further assessment for pediatric patients struggling with potty training and continence
  • Demonstrate 4 treatment techniques to improve participation in toileting for children with bowel and bladder dysfunction
  • Describe the role other disciplines play in bowel and bladder health
